How does the sun burn without oxygen?

0

The sun does not burn, it is not chemical combustion. What goes on in the stellar core is nuclear fusion, where hydrogen nucleus are merged under incredible pressure and temperature to form helium nucleus. That is the process we have in H bombs, which also do not need oxygen to blow up.
